This well presented double fronted family home offers great accommodation in a great location. Situated in a highly regarded Reigate residential road, within easy reach of Reigate town centre, train station and many of the fabulous local schools.
The house is welcoming and bright throughout, enjoying a south and west aspect to the rear and side, with well proportioned accommodation. The sitting room is a delightful room, triple aspect with a brick fireplace creating a lovely focal point, doors lead through to a large conservatory from which the views over the garden can be enjoyed. Across the hallway is the kitchen/dining room. The kitchen has been fitted with a comprehensive range of units with a breakfast bar defining the areas between kitchen and dining. The dining area has beautiful parquet flooring. A useful utility area completes the downstairs accommodation.
Upstairs the master bedroom has the luxury of an ensuite bathroom and fitted cupboards. There are three more double bedrooms, two of which have fitted wardrobes and a lovely family bathroom which has both a bath and shower.
Outside
The property has plenty of off road parking on the driveway in addition to the double garage.
The garden offers a high degree of privacy due to wonderful mature hedging, with a large patio are for table and chairs for entertaining in the summer months. The garden has a south and westerly aspect to make the most of the sun. The remainder of the garden is mainly laid to lawn with many mature plants and shrubs.
Reigate offers an impressive range of shops and services. Offering the ultimate in retail therapy, up-market independent boutiques, traditional butchers and well-stocked delicatessens specialise in mouth-watering local produce. In addition to familiar chains, Island House, Buenos Aires Argentinian Steak House and Giggling Squid Thai Restaurant are perennial favourites. For delicious lunches, The Chapel and Cullendars get great reviews.
Commuting to London from Reigate station takes around 40 minutes into London Bridge or Victoria. Commuting to London is also possible through Redhill mainline station, 2 miles away, which offers direct routes into London Bridge and Victoria from 28 minutes, Gatwick airport in 15 minutes, along with routes to a variety of other destinations, whilst The Channel Tunnel is within a 90 minute drive.

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
